We live on site in Bridgetown Mill, which dates back to the 17th Century. Once a grain and flour producing mill, it was last used for milling during the Second World War. The building is in good repair and much of the mill machinery is in working order. The mill is listed as being the largest on Exmoor. There is plenty
of interest nearby, including Red Deer and Exmoor ponies roaming free
over heather-clad moors, crystal
clear rivers or streams full of wild trout and over 50 varieties of birds can be
seen from the campsite. An excellent local inn opposite serves lunchtime and evening meals and there is a village shop and post office at nearby Winsford. The carefully maintained campsite covers 4 acres of level grass between the River Exe and our own mill stream. Every pitch has ample space and enjoys its own section of the bank beside the fast flowing clear water of the river or the mill stream. A further acre of our land provides for a leisurely stroll up to our weir.
